Output e90405e95af8774528539aae494422512ac76e3502b84b19d6a7ae3558bf8dea: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afe6dd553e348cbf33df668ea489fd184941b15 OP_EQUAL
address
3LCMDLG18xLm4WeQBXFFP86KJshjxUkv1C
transaction
e90405e95af8774528539aae494422512ac76e3502b84b19d6a7ae3558bf8dea
spent
true